Vietjet, Vietnam’s leading budget carrier, has announced exciting developments to expand its network in Asia. The airline recently celebrated a decade of successful air travel between Vietnam and South Korea by unveiling a new route connecting the coastal city of Nha Trang to Daegu, South Korea’s fourth-largest city. This announcement, made at the Vietnam – South Korea Tourism Promotion and Cultural Cooperation Forum in Seoul, reinforces Vietjet’s commitment to offering extensive connections between the two nations.

Vietjet Expands Network To China And South Korea

Since its inaugural flight in July 2014, Vietjet has grown significantly. To date, it has carried over ten million passengers on more than 37 regular and charter flights between Vietnam and South Korea. This continuous expansion highlights Vietjet’s crucial role in facilitating travel, fostering economic ties, and promoting tourism and cultural exchange between the two countries.

Further bolstering regional connectivity, Vietjet also inaugurated a new route from Ho Chi Minh City to Xi’an, the capital of Shaanxi province in China, on July 1. Operating four round-trip flights weekly, the new China route complements Vietjet’s successful launches of flights to Shanghai and Chengdu. It further solidifies its growing network and strengthens regional cooperation.

In India, Vietjet has implemented strategic expansions. It has established a total of 29 weekly round-trip flights, creating seamless connections between Vietnam and four major Indian cities. These are New Delhi, Mumbai, Ahmedabad, and Kochi. They have a modern fleet, dedicated crew, and attractive promotions specifically designed for Indian customers. Vietjet has established a strong presence and exceptional connectivity between Vietnam and India.

Currently, Vietjet Airlines holds the record for the most direct routes between Vietnam and India. It connects major cities like Hanoi, Ho Chi Minh City, and Da Nang with New Delhi, Mumbai, and Ahmedabad. This extensive network exemplifies Vietjet’s dedication to enhancing travel experiences and fostering cultural exchange between Vietnam and India.
